An official Census 2011 detail of Budaun, a district of Uttar Pradesh has been released by Directorate of Census Operations in Uttar Pradesh. Enumeration of key persons was also done by census officials in Budaun District of Uttar Pradesh.
In 2011, Budaun had population of 3,681,896 of which male and female were 1,967,759 and 1,714,137 respectively.
In 2001 census, Budaun had a population of 3,069,426 of which males were 1,666,669 and remaining 1,402,757 were females.

Budaun District Density 2011
The initial provisional data released by census India 2011, shows that density of Budaun district for 2011 is 712 people per sq. km. In 2001, Budaun district density was at 594 people per sq. km. Budaun district administers 5,168 square kilometers of areas.
Budaun Literacy Rate 2011
Average literacy rate of Budaun in 2011 were 51.29 compared to 38.17 of 2001. If things are looked out at gender wise, male and female literacy were 60.98 and 40.09 respectively. For 2001 census, same figures stood at 48.96 and 25.14 in Budaun District. Total literate in Budaun District were 1,547,477 of which male and female were 986,501 and 560,976 respectively. In 2001, Budaun District had 924,643 in its district.
Budaun Sex Ratio 2011
With regards to Sex Ratio in Budaun, it stood at 871 per 1000 male compared to 2001 census figure of 842. The average national sex ratio in India is 940 as per latest reports of Census 2011 Directorate.
In 2011 census, child sex ratio is 899 girls per 1000 boys compared to figure of 890 girls per 1000 boys of 2001 census data.
Budaun Child Population 2011
In census enumeration, data regarding child under 0-6 age were also collected for all districts including Budaun. There were total 664,909 children under age of 0-6 against 646,756 of 2001 census. Of total 664,909 male and female were 350,112 and 314,797 respectively. Child Sex Ratio as per census 2011 was 899 compared to 890 of census 2001. In 2011, Children under 0-6 formed 18.06 percent of Budaun District compared to 21.07 percent of 2001. There was net change of -3.01 percent in this compared to previous census of India.
Budaun Houseless Census
In 2011, total 540 families live on footpath or without any roof cover in Budaun district of Uttar Pradesh. Total Population of all who lived without roof at the time of Census 2011 numbers to 2,786. This approx 0.08% of total population of Budaun district.

Budaun District Urban/Rural 2011
Out of the total Budaun population for 2011 census, 17.51 percent lives in urban regions of district. In total 644,595 people lives in urban areas of which males are 337,383 and females are 307,212.
Sex Ratio in urban region of Budaun district is 911 as per 2011 census data. Similarly child sex ratio in Budaun district was 913 in 2011 census.
Child population (0-6) in urban region was 98,439 of which males and females were 51,450 and 46,989. This child population figure of Budaun district is 15.25 % of total urban population.
Average literacy rate in Budaun district as per census 2011 is 59.14 % of which males and females are 65.26 % and 52.40 % literates respectively.
In actual number 322,972 people are literate in urban region of which males and females are 186,608 and 136,364 respectively.
As per 2011 census, 82.49 % population of Budaun districts lives in rural areas of villages. The total Budaun district population living in rural areas is 3,037,301 of which males and females are 1,630,376 and 1,406,925 respectively.
In rural areas of Budaun district, sex ratio is 863 females per 1000 males. If child sex ratio data of Budaun district is considered, figure is 897 girls per 1000 boys.
Child population in the age 0-6 is 566,470 in rural areas of which males were 298,662 and females were 267,808. The child population comprises 18.32 % of total rural population of Budaun district.
Literacy rate in rural areas of Budaun district is 49.56 % as per census data 2011. Gender wise, male and female literacy stood at 60.06 and 37.28 percent respectively.
In total, 1,224,505 people were literate of which males and females were 799,893 and 424,612 respectively.
